Abstract

The present invention relates to cosmetics containers, it is characterised in that including:Lid, the lower part of above-mentioned lid are combined with powder puff;And pressurization part, it is combined with the top of vessel, the discharge for the cosmetics for being contained in said vesse body is controlled by lifting, is combined by the top of above-mentioned pressurization part with above-mentioned lid, above-mentioned powder puff is positioned over the inside of above-mentioned pressurization part.The cosmetics containers of the present invention have following advantageous effects, if pressurizeed by pressurization part to the mouth body of vessel, the cosmetics of mouth body injection then can be directly fed through to the surface of the powder puff positioned at the inside of pressurization part, to make cosmetics equably be stained on the front surface of powder puff, so as to improve the convenience of user of service.

Background technology
In general, protecting skin in order to obtain and allowing skin glosser according to people, improve wrinkle and other effects, foundation cream is widely used (foundation) liquid make-up such as Solic cosmetic or suncream (sun block) such as.At this time, user of service can use After cosmetics are stained on powder puff (puff), the mode of skin is applied to.
Powder puff can be sold with the state being accommodated in cosmetics containers, usually can be in the lid of cosmetics containers Inside houses powder puff etc..Therefore, in order to which using cosmetics, user of service powder puff can be taken out by opening lid, and that will set The state of finger is clipped in stretch cord of powder puff etc. makes powder puff contact cosmetics, to make the cosmetics of ormal weight be stained on powder puff.
But since existing cosmetics containers as described above are separately provided with powder puff, thus exist and asked using cumbersome Topic.That is, user of service needs to take out powder puff from cosmetics containers to use, during this, it is possible to lead because powder puff drops Cause to waste cosmetics or make powder puff contaminated, also there is the hidden danger for being possible to lose powder puff.
Also, due to being smeared in existing cosmetics containers, it is necessary to directly pick cosmetics using powder puff, it is being stained with Take and cosmetics are likely to result in during smearing cosmetics using uneven, thus be possible to make troubles.
Therefore, be recently developed following product, i.e. ejection-type vessel preserve cosmetics, equipped with container sheet The lid that the top of body is combined, powder puff are fixed on the upper end of above-mentioned lid, if making lid to vessel by using personnel Mouth body portion pressurization, then by lower section from mouth body to powder puff spray cosmetics, to make cosmetics be seeped into the surface of powder puff so that The cosmetic applying of powder puff will be stained in skin to hold the state of vessel by making user of service.
But in this case, due to being stained on the cosmetics of powder puff for use, user of service need to hold vessel By cosmetic applying in skin, thus there is asking that because of the size of vessel user of service can only be inconvenienced Topic.Also, as cosmetics are consumed, the weight of vessel changes so that user of service can not obtain holding container Skilled sense during body, so that the pressure that skin is patted with powder puff is irregular, the amount that there are used cosmetics can not The problem of reaching required amount.
Also, in the case where providing cosmetics to the lower section of powder puff by lid, in order to make user of service's useization Cosmetic, cosmetics need to penetrate through powder puff, be oozed out to the upper face of powder puff, thus have can for the cosmetics not oozed out to the surface of powder puff It can be not used by and be wasted, since cosmetics are had to the inside that residues in powder puff all the time, thus presence can not protect powder puff The problem of holding cleaning.
Also, if user of service discharges cosmetics in the state of the upper face of powder puff is externally exposed using lid, The then injection pressure based on vessel, the part strength perforation powder puff of the cosmetics supplied to the lower section of powder puff, can make Cosmetics depart from powder puff upper face, therefore exist be possible to waste cosmetics, and due to cosmetics to periphery splash, Thus there is a possibility that the problem of user of service feels inconvenience and is possible to not feel well.

Lid 110 can together be lifted with the state being combined with pressurization part 130 with pressurization part 130, be sprayed along mouth body 102 The cosmetics penetrated can reach powder puff 120 via the inner space of pressurization part 130.At this time, if vessel 100 receives cosmetics Spray containers 101 are dissolved in, then cosmetics can together or with gas componant be discharged with gas componant.In the case, gas componant The inner space of pressurization part 130 is flowed into, but is closed with the upper side of pressurization part 130 by lid 110, pressurization part 130 Inner space pressure rise therewith, it is possible to causing gas componant and cosmetics etc. to be let out along the lateral surface of lid 110 Leakage.Therefore, in the present embodiment, can be this by being solved the problems, such as equipped with gas outlet channels 114, and to gas outlet channels 114 etc., it will be described in detail with reference to Fig. 8.
Fig. 8 is the figure for showing gas componant discharged path in the cosmetics containers of one embodiment of the invention.
With reference to Fig. 8, lid 110 can also include gas outlet channels 114, above-mentioned gas passing away 114 for make from The gas componant that the cosmetics that vessel 100 sprays are included penetrates through powder puff 120 and is discharged to outside.At this time, gas discharge is logical Road 114 means the outside tap 1112 for being formed at handle portion 111 and the inner side tap for being formed at powder puff fixed part 113 The space connected between 1133.
Outside tap 1112 is formed at the exterior face of handle portion 111, for discharging gas componant to outside.At this time, lead to Crossing outside tap 1112 can be for by the gas componant of the inflow of inner side tap 1133 to the gas componant of outside discharge.
If user of service's cosmetics to be discharged, user of service will utilize lid 110 to hold the state of handle portion 111 Decline pressurization part 130, therefore, outside tap 1112 can be blocked by finger of user of service etc..Therefore, outside tap 1112 are collectively formed at one end of the handle 1111 of handle portion 111, and are arranged at the both sides of handle 1111, at least make to be formed with this Outside tap 1112 in the side of handle 1111 is not blocked, so as to be smoothly discharged gas componant.
Alternatively, outside tap 1112 can be formed at the side of handle portion 111, and if outside tap 1112 is formed at handle The side of hand 111, even if then user of service holds handle 1111, is blocked prevented also from outside tap 1112 by finger.
As described above, in order to make outside tap 1112 be not used personnel's screening when user of service holds lid 110 Gear, can form at least one outside tap 1112 in the upper side of the two sides of handle 1111 or handle portion 111, side etc., By the position of outside tap 1112 and from the limitation of the present embodiment.And outside tap 1112 can be formed at except handle portion The exterior face of handle portion 111 outside 111 bottom surfaces, if this is because handle portion 111 bottom surfaces formed with outboard row Portal 1112, then outside tap 1112 can not discharge gas componant to outside, on the contrary to the inner space of pressurization part 130 again Introduce gas componant.
Inner side tap 1133 is formed at the bottom surfaces of powder puff fixed part 113, come make the gas componant of perforation powder puff 120 to The inside of powder puff fixed part flows into.The gas componant flowed into along inner side tap 1133 flows into the inside of lid 110, specifically Ground, the gas componant flowed into along inner side tap 1133 flow into the inside of the first powder puff fixed part 1131, can pass through the first powder Flutter the inside of fixed part 1131 with the inside of handle portion 111 and outside tap 1112 to be connected, to discharge gas componant.
Formed by powder puff 120 by sponge form etc., can make by injection pressure to come to the gas componant that powder puff 120 sprays Powder puff 120 is penetrated through, the gas componant for penetrating through the bottom surfaces of powder puff 120 upwards can be by inner side tap 1133 and along being formed at The gas outlet channels 114 of the inside of first powder puff fixed part 1131, and by the outside tap 1112 of handle portion 111 to Outside discharge.
Hereinafter, the flowing of gas componant is illustrated.First, when pressurization part 130 declines in cosmetics containers 10, once Property by inner space from mouth body 102 to pressurization part 130 spray cosmetics, at this time, gas componant can be included in cosmetics.
In this case, if maintaining the state that is completely sealed of inner space of pressurization part 130, by gas componant, The inner space pressure of pressurization part 130 is set to increase, finally, gas componant will pass through the bound fraction of lid 110 and pressurization part 130 Outflow.At this time, since cosmetics included in gas componant also together flow out, thus pollution cosmetics containers 10 are possible to Appearance.
But in the present embodiment, it is additionally formed with making this gas componant to the path of outside outflow.Specifically, The gas componant disposably discharged is by penetrating through powder puff 120 and along the inner side tap of the first powder puff fixed part 1131 1133 flow into the inside of the first powder puff fixed part 1131.Afterwards, gas componant is via the upper of the first powder puff fixed part 1131 Portion carrys out the inside inflow to handle portion 111, and can be by being formed at the outside tap 1112 of handle portion 111 come natural to outside Discharge on ground.
Therefore, in the present embodiment, by making to be contained in sprayed makeup when spraying cosmetics from vessel 100 The gas componant of product is along the gas outlet channels 114 being connected with inner side tap 1133 and outside tap 1112 to outside Discharge, to make gas componant can not be flowed out from the inner space of pressurization part 130, so as to simply solve gas componant along adding The problem of bound fraction of splenium 130 and lid 110 flows out.
Also, when from spray containers 101 with high-pressure injection cosmetics when, it is possible to cause cosmetics instantaneous crystallization with Powder shaped is dispersed, and in the present embodiment, due to can make cosmetics via powder puff 120 and along gas outlet channels 114 to Outside discharge, thus can not can be flowed out by making powder to outside, to protect the respiratory tract of user of service.

Powder puff 120 can obtain cosmetics with the state positioned at the inner space that pressurization part 130 described later is equipped with, specifically Ground, powder puff 120 can obtain cosmetics to separate the state of predetermined distance from mouth body 102., in the present embodiment, can be to this Powder puff 120 fully passes through the cosmetics that mouth body 102 sprays from spray containers 101.At this time, spray and be stained with from mouth body 102 Can be according to separated by a distance and different between mouth body 102 and powder puff 120 in the area of the cosmetics of powder puff 120.Specifically, if every Distance to be opened to become larger, then cosmetics will be distributed evenly in all areas of powder puff 120, if but it is excessive separated by a distance, cause powder Cosmetics will be also ejected into by flutterring 120 outside (inner side of pressurization part 130), if reducing separated by a distance, will be reduced cosmetics and be stained with To the area of the part of powder puff 120.In the present embodiment, as an example, can be separated by a distance 5mm to 20mm, certainly, this can Viscosity according to the size of powder puff 120, the injection pressure of mouth body 102 and cosmetics etc. and it is different.
Also, different from conventional cosmetics containers, powder puff 120 is by making the surface for speckling with cosmetics become directly contact The surface of the skin of user of service, even if to cause internal penetration of the cosmetics not to powder puff 120, also can be swimmingly using makeup Product, so as to reduce the usage amount of cosmetics, and can effectively manage the sanitary condition of powder puff 120.
